Gold currently trades for around $2000 US/oz. (or $100 AU/g). Yet,
one gold bar is virtually indistinguishable from another.
If you have a gold bar and want to sell it, the only way you can compete against other sellers of gold bars is on price.
You are at the mercy of the market.
Gold may be valuable, but it’s also a commodity.
Here’s the thing...
Data science skills are also highly valuable.
Yet, most data scientists have similar qualifications, skills and experiences, making them virtually indistinguishable from one another.
This puts them at the mercy of employers.
It's also how the paradoxical situation of data scientists, with in-demand skills, who can’t find work, can occur.
Just because your skills are valuable doesn’t mean you’re not also a commodity.
